Family Wedding 1912
Wedding of Ada Gertrude WHITE to William YOULE 1912. Photo taken at 21 Longfield Road, St Andrews Park, Bristol
People in photo include: Arnold Miller
Date & Place: at St Andrews Park in Ashley, Bristol England

In 1889, in the year that Ada Gertrude (White) Youle was born, on March 31st, the Eiffel Tower was inaugurated. Because the elevators were not yet in operation, officials had to climb to the top of the tower - it took an hour. On May 15th, the Tower opened to the public - still without working elevators - but around 30,000 visitors still made the climb. The elevators went into operation on the 26th. The Tower wasn't considered aesthetically pleasing at the time but is now one of the most iconic structures in the world.

In 1901, shortly after beginning his second term, President McKinley was assassinated by the self proclaimed anarchist Leon Czolgosz. The last President to have served in the Civil War - he began as a private and ended the war as a brevet major - McKinley was a Republican. First elected in 1896, he was re-elected in 1900. Six months after the swearing in, McKinley was shot - and died of the gangrene that set in as a result.
